Across TCGA cell cohorts, MAN1B1 mutation is significantly associated with the RNA expression of many other genes, with 15 significant associations in total. BLOOD_Leukemia shows the largest number of these associations.

The most reproducible MAN1B1-associated genes across cancer lineages are GJD4, RAB19, and LRP1B. Each is linked with MAN1B1 in more than 1 cancer types. Because this analysis shows association rather than direction, both MAN1B1-to-partner and partner-to-MAN1B1 results are reported.
